  • Publication number: 20230330388
    Abstract: A catheter includes: a tubular structure having a longitudinal axis; wherein the tubular structure comprises first and second rings arranged in series along the longitudinal axis, the first and second rings being respective closed-loops, wherein the first ring lies within a first plane that is substantially perpendicular to the longitudinal axis; wherein the tubular structure comprises a first connecting member having a first end, a second end, and a member body; and a second connecting member comprises a first end, a second end, and a member body; and wherein the second end of the first connecting member and the first end of the second connecting member are connected to the first ring, and disposed across from each other, and wherein the second end of the second connective member is connected to the second ring, and wherein the respective member bodies are configured to rotate and/or bent.

  • Publication number: 20220265448
    Abstract: A method of assembling an apparatus for delivering an implant to a deployment site in a patient's vasculature, includes: positioning an implant engagement member at least partially within a lumen of a tubular structure, the tubular structure having a sidewall comprising a pattern of wires or struts; heating the implant engagement member; pressing at least a portion of the sidewall of the tubular structure radially inward into a surface of the implant engagement member so that the wires or the struts of the sidewall penetrate into the surface and create corresponding recesses therein; and after the recesses are created in the surface of the implant engagement member, hardening the implant engagement member.

  • Patent number: 10744011
    Abstract: A monolithic device comprising an ultra-dense stent cell pattern including a plurality of structural members that diverts the majority of blood flow without restricting blood flow completely. The method of making medical devices comprises vapor depositing an initial film onto a substrate, laser cutting a device pattern through the initial film, electropolishing the patterned device while disposed on the substrate, and releasing the patterned device from the substrate.
